4/13 Thomas Frank, Moral Failures & Jason Leopold, Govt Tracks Occupy Wall Street

April 13, 2012

Author Thomas Frank on the crisis of accountability plaguing our nation.  How the elite handle crisis management, the corrupting force of money and the complete collapse of professional ideals.   His Huffington Post article “Too Smart to Fail: Notes on an Age of Folly”.  In the better half, Truth-out reporter, Jason Leopold, on government’s role stifling Occupy Wall Street.
